Consider the following statements
I. Boiling point of water is 273 K.
II. Evaporation takes place at all temperature.
Which of the statement(s) given above is/are correct?

A

Only I

B

Only II

C

Both I and II

D

Neither I nor II

To solve the question, we need to evaluate the two statements provided: 1. **Statement I**: Boiling point of water is 273 K. 2. **Statement II**: Evaporation takes place at all temperatures. ### Step 1: Analyze Statement I - The boiling point of water is commonly known to be 100°C at standard atmospheric pressure. To convert this to Kelvin: \[ 100°C + 273.15 = 373.15 K \] - Therefore, the boiling point of water is approximately 373 K, not 273 K. This means **Statement I is incorrect**. ### Step 2: Analyze Statement II - Evaporation is the process where liquid turns into vapor. This process can occur at any temperature, even at temperatures below the boiling point. - For example, water can evaporate at room temperature. Thus, **Statement II is correct**. ### Step 3: Conclusion - Since Statement I is incorrect and Statement II is correct, the answer to the question is that only the second statement is correct. ### Final Answer - The correct option is: **Only statement II is correct**. ---
